Our Bosch had been complaining about low water pressure, was stopping at random, and had taken it into its head to heat the rinse water.



The Bosch man came out and showed that although we had plenty of pressure (3 bar), the actual flow rate through the inlet hose was pathetic. Replaced hose and all is well.



In terms of symptoms, I could understand its complaint about low pressure since here, from time to time, mains pressure suddenly drops to 2 bar for a couple of days. But the other symptoms made no sense at all.
